Stop Basement Flooding with a Sump Pump System
A sump pump system acts as a crucial line against basement flooding. This effective setup includes a sump pit, which collects water that flows into your basement. A submersible pump then discharges the collected water outside of your home, preventing destruction.
To maximize the performance of your sump pump system, regular maintenance are necessary. This includes clearing the basin clear from debris and examining the pump's activity.

Selecting the Right Sump Pump for Your Basement Needs
Protecting your home's foundation from flooding is essential. A properly functioning sump pump can be your first line of defense against water damage. However, with so many choices available, selecting the right sump pump for your specific needs can seem overwhelming. Consider the dimensions of your basement and the amount of rainfall your area typically experiences. A robust pump may be necessary if you live in a region prone to heavy storms.
It's also important to select between submersible and pedestal pumps. Submersible pumps are completely submerged in the water, while pedestal pumps have the motor outside the pit. Submersible pumps are generally more powerful, but pedestal pumps may be easier to install.
Finally, don't forget about a alternate power source. A battery backup system or generator can ensure your sump pump continues to function even during a power outage.
Fixing Common Sump Pump Issues
A sump pump is a vital part for protecting your dwelling from water damage. While they are generally reliable, there are some common problems that can arise. Here's a look at some of the most frequent sump pump concerns and how to resolve them.
One common situation is a failing sensor. If the mechanism isn't detecting water, the pump won't activate. Examine the sensor for debris.
Another common cause is a clogged discharge pipe. This can result from sediment gathering in the pipe. Clear the channel to improve water flow.
Finally, a faulty pump sump alarm electrical component is another likelihood. If your pump won't run, it may be time to swap out the motor. Periodic maintenance can help prevent these common troubles.
